LLWR is a UK repository site and facility that is permitted to receive all categories of low level waste (LLW). The LLWR site receives low level solid waste from a range of customers, such as the nuclear industry, the Ministry of Defence, non-nuclear industries, educational, medical and research establishments. Through the application of the waste management hierarchy, LLWR enables customers to access alternative options that consider re-use, recycling or other means of disposal where practicable.
